sverigesradio-mcp
Verified Safeby KSAklfszf921
Overview
Accessing Swedish radio programs, podcasts, live streams, news, and traffic information for AI assistants.
Installation
npx sverigesradio-mcpEnvironment Variables
- MCP_AUTH_TOKEN
- PORT
- SR_API_TIMEOUT_MS
- ALLOWED_ORIGINS
- SESSION_TTL_MS
- RATE_LIMIT_REQUESTS
Security Notes
The server uses environment variables (e.g., MCP_AUTH_TOKEN) for sensitive data, implements Zod for robust input validation, and includes CORS, rate limiting, and session management. It fetches data from Sveriges Radio's public API, which does not require authentication itself. No direct 'eval' usage, code obfuscation, or obvious malicious patterns were found in the provided source. Standard, well-vetted Node.js dependencies are used. The security measures primarily protect the MCP server endpoint and manage access to the public upstream API.
Similar Servers
kolada-mcp
Provides AI applications with tools to access and analyze Sweden's municipal and regional statistics from the Kolada API, enabling natural language queries against thousands of Key Performance Indicators (KPIs) through semantic search and data retrieval.
KOLADA-MCP
Provides LLMs and AI chatbots with direct access to over 5,000 Key Performance Indicators and statistical data for all 290 Swedish municipalities and 21 regions from the Kolada API.
Kolada-MCP
Facilitates LLM access to comprehensive Swedish municipal and regional statistics from the Kolada API for key performance indicator (KPI) data retrieval and analysis.
Skolverket-MCP
Provides AI assistants access to Skolverket's open APIs (Läroplan, Skolenhetsregistret, Planned Educations) for searching, comparing, and analyzing Swedish education data and statistics.